Sore Wrist Worth the Win?
By Susan Mercedes. Filed in Friends |Once a month I spend an evening with 11 other ladies for a game of Bunko, a dice rolling game. Our group gives away 5 prizes at each game. This means there are 5 winners. There are 12 of us who play to win. That leaves 7 of us that are losers. My odds feel better in Vegas.
Except this month…I won.
If I look around my house, I have practically furnished it with accent pieces, filled the cabinets with platters and stocked up with lotions from this simple game.
But the gifts aren’t why I do it. I love these ladies. We eat dinner, drink wine, chat and scream with excitement all while we roll three little dice. Based on the multitasking involved it might explain why men aren’t in our group. That and they weren’t invited.
